问:普通人应该如何看待Stress的变化? 答:Sarvam 30B performs strongly across core language modeling tasks, particularly in mathematics, coding, and knowledge benchmarks. It achieves 97.0 on Math500, matching or exceeding several larger models in its class. On coding benchmarks, it scores 92.1 on HumanEval and 92.7 on MBPP, and 70.0 on LiveCodeBench v6, outperforming many similarly sized models on practical coding tasks.
